After nearly 25 years of dedicated service as Director of Communications with the Paso del Norte Health Foundation, Ida Ortegon is retiring. Throughout her tenure, Ida has been an integral part of advancing the Health Foundation’s mission to promote health and well-being across our region — bringing compassion, creativity, and commitment to every initiative she touched.

Before joining the Health Foundation, Ida spent over 18 years at Providence Memorial Hospital, where she launched her lifelong career in health communications and community engagement. At the Health Foundation, she worked closely with grantees, program staff, and partners on initiatives that made a lasting impact — from bringing potable water to colonias in Cd. Juárez and encouraging healthy eating and physical activity to supporting mental health programs throughout the Paso del Norte region.

Ida also played a key role in supporting the Paso del Norte Community Foundation’s communications and fundraising efforts, helping strengthen community partnerships and share inspiring stories of impact.

Reflecting on her time with the Foundations, Ida shared:

“I love my community and am honored to do my part in making a healthy difference. As I step into a new chapter in my life, I’m grateful to Tracy, our board, and all my co-workers, vendors, contract support, and friends who made my day-to-day work possible.”
